People add chlorine bleach to their swimming pools primarily to disinfect the water, killing harmful bacteria, viruses, and algae. This process, known as chlorination, is crucial for maintaining safe and clean swimming conditions, preventing common pool-related illnesses and cloudy water.
Why is Chlorine So Important for Your Swimming Pool?
Chlorine is the workhorse of pool sanitation. Its primary role is to oxidize and disinfect the water, making it safe for swimmers. Without it, your pool can quickly become a breeding ground for microorganisms.
Understanding the Science Behind Pool Chlorination
When you add chlorine to your pool water, it reacts to form hypochlorous acid (HOCl) and hypochlorite ions (OCl-). These are the active sanitizing agents. They work by breaking down the cell walls of bacteria and viruses, rendering them harmless.
- Oxidation: Chlorine attacks and breaks down organic contaminants like sweat, oils, and lotions.
- Disinfection: It effectively kills harmful pathogens that can cause ear infections, skin rashes, and gastrointestinal issues.
- Algae Control: Chlorine prevents algae growth, which can make your pool water green and slippery.
What Happens If You Don’t Add Bleach (or Chlorine) to Your Pool?
Neglecting to add chlorine to your pool can have several unpleasant and potentially dangerous consequences. The water can become cloudy, develop an unpleasant odor, and support the growth of harmful bacteria and algae.
- Increased Risk of Illness: Swimmers are more susceptible to infections.
- Algae Blooms: The water can turn green, brown, or even black.
- Corrosion: Unbalanced water can damage pool equipment and surfaces.
- Unpleasant Odors: The "chlorine smell" is often a sign of chloramines, which form when chlorine reacts with contaminants, indicating a need for more free chlorine.
Types of Chlorine Products for Pools
While the question specifically mentions "bleach," it’s important to note that there are various forms of chlorine available for pool maintenance. Household bleach (sodium hypochlorite) can be used, but specialized pool chlorine products are often more effective and stable.
Liquid Chlorine (Sodium Hypochlorite)
This is essentially the same active ingredient as household bleach, but it’s formulated for pools at a higher concentration (typically 10-12.5%). It’s a fast-acting sanitizer and shock treatment.
- Pros: Quick to raise chlorine levels, easy to dose.
- Cons: Less stable than other forms, can degrade over time, requires frequent additions.
Granular Chlorine (Calcium Hypochlorite)
Often referred to as "cal-hypo," this is a popular choice for shocking pools and raising chlorine levels quickly. It’s a dry form that dissolves in water.
- Pros: Effective for shocking, relatively inexpensive.
- Cons: Can increase calcium hardness, may leave a cloudy residue if not dissolved properly.
Tablet Chlorine (Trichloroisocyanuric Acid – Trichlor)
These slow-dissolving tablets are convenient for maintaining a consistent chlorine level. They are typically placed in a skimmer basket or a floating dispenser.
- Pros: Provides a steady release of chlorine, convenient for ongoing maintenance.
- Cons: Can lower pH over time, contains cyanuric acid (stabilizer) which builds up.
How Much Bleach Should You Add to Your Pool?
The amount of chlorine needed depends on several factors, including pool size, bather load, sunlight exposure, and water temperature. It’s crucial to test your water regularly with a reliable test kit.
General Guideline for Liquid Chlorine (10% Sodium Hypochlorite):
- To raise free chlorine by 1 ppm (part per million) in 10,000 gallons: Approximately 1 gallon of liquid chlorine.
Always follow the manufacturer’s instructions and consult your pool professional if you’re unsure. Over-chlorination can be as problematic as under-chlorination.
The Role of Stabilizer (Cyanuric Acid)
For outdoor pools, cyanuric acid (CYA), often called "stabilizer" or "conditioner," is essential. Sunlight degrades free chlorine rapidly. CYA acts like sunscreen for your chlorine, protecting it from UV rays.
- Ideal CYA Levels: 30-50 ppm for most pools.
- Too Little CYA: Chlorine dissipates quickly, requiring constant replenishment.
- Too Much CYA: Can reduce chlorine’s effectiveness, making it harder to sanitize.
When to Shock Your Pool
Shocking your pool involves adding a large dose of chlorine to break down combined chlorine (chloramines) and kill any contaminants. You should shock your pool:
- After heavy use.
- After a rainstorm.
- If the water appears cloudy or has an algae problem.
- Periodically (e.g., weekly or bi-weekly during peak season).
Alternatives to Chlorine for Pool Sanitization
While chlorine is the most common sanitizer, other options exist for those seeking alternatives or supplementary treatments.
Saltwater Chlorination Systems
These systems use a salt chlorine generator to convert salt (sodium chloride) into chlorine gas, which then sanitizes the water.
- Pros: Gentler on skin and eyes, provides a more consistent chlorine level.
- Cons: Higher initial cost, requires regular salt additions and cell cleaning.
Bromine
Bromine is another halogen sanitizer that works similarly to chlorine. It’s often used in hot tubs and spas because it’s more stable at higher temperatures.
- Pros: Effective in a wider pH range, less irritating than chlorine for some.
- Cons: More expensive than chlorine, can be less effective at killing certain algae.
Other Sanitizers
Ozone generators and UV sanitizers can be used as supplementary systems to reduce chlorine demand, but they typically don’t eliminate the need for a residual sanitizer like chlorine or bromine.
Frequently Asked Questions About Pool Bleach
### Can I use regular household bleach in my pool?
Yes, you can use regular household bleach (sodium hypochlorite), but it’s generally less concentrated (around 5-8%) than pool-specific liquid chlorine (10-12.5%). You’ll need to use more of it, and it may not be as stable. Always ensure it contains only sodium hypochlorite and water, with no added fragrances or cleaners.
### How often should I add bleach to my pool?
The frequency depends on your pool’s size, usage, and environmental factors. Typically, you’ll need to add liquid chlorine a few times a week to maintain the desired free chlorine level, usually between 1-4 ppm. Regular water testing is key to determining the right schedule.
